Filing 4 ORDER signed by the Honorable Philip G. Reinhard on 7/9/2020: Plaintiff's complaint is stricken for failure to meet the pleading requirements of Fed. R. Civ. P. 8(a)(2) and failure to state a claim on which relief may be granted. 28 U.S.C. 1915(e)(2)(ii). On or before August 7, 2020, plaintiff shall file an amended complaint identifying the agency she alleges engaged in the discriminatory action against her or this case will be dismissed for failure to state a claim. Plaintiff's application to proceed in forma pauperis #3 is stayed pending filing of an amended complaint. Mailed notice(sb, ) |
